Various grounds have been raised but one of the primary grounds for challenging the notice under section 148A(d) and the notice under section 148 of the Act both dated 7th April 2022 is that order as well as the notice both mention the authority that has granted approval, is the Principal Commissioner of Income Tax ("PCIT"), Mumbai 5 and the approval has been granted on 7th April 2022. 2. Mr. Gandhi is correct in saying that the Assessment Year ("AY") is 2018-19 and, therefore, since more than three years have expired from the end of the assessment year, Sanctioning Authority under section 151(ii) of the Act should be the Principal Chief Commissioner of Income Tax ("PCCIT") and not the PCIT. The impugned order and the impugned notice both dated 22nd April 2022 state that the Authority that has accorded the sanction is the PCIT, Mumbai-5. The matter pertains to Assessment Year ("AY") 2018-2019 and since the impugned order as well as the notice are issued on 22nd April 2022, both have been issued beyond a period of three years.
